Once upon a time, Rob Seastrom <rs@seastrom.com> said:
> Along the same lines I'm troubled by the lack of divergent sources
> these days - everything seems slaved to GPS either directly or
> indirectly (might be nice to have stuff out there that got its time
> exclusively via Galileo or Glonass).
Since you mentioned GLONASS: it had a 10+ hour outage yesterday,
apparently due to a bad ephemeris upload. Did anybody have a
GLONASS-using NTP server experience problems?
